  11. Merino strikes at the death for Spain to send Portugal and Ronaldo limping out
    #11 Score 56
    Merino strikes at the death for Spain to send Portugal and Ronaldo limping out

    It ended with a goal from a tall, slightly ungainly figure driving through the centre-forward position – but perhaps not the one that the narrative demanded. In stoppage time, Mikel Merino ran on to Ferran Torres’s through-ball and, with impressive calm after a scrappy game that had largely lacked it, rolled the winner past Diogo Costa.
